India’s Mammoth Laundromat: Discover the Largest in the Nation

The concept of a laundromat, a self-service laundry facility, is relatively new to the sprawling subcontinent of India. Yet, as urbanization and modern conveniences continue to pervade the country, several innovative and large-scale laundromats have emerged to cater to the growing demand. One such laudable venture that stands out is the Giggbang Laundromat in Bengaluru, often touted as the largest laundromat in India.

Sprawling over an impressive 5,000 square feet, Giggbang Laundromat redefines the traditional laundry experience, offering a clean, efficient, and customer-friendly space for residents and businesses alike. This bustling hub is not just about washing clothes; it’s a testament to India’s burgeoning service industry and evolving consumer behavior.

Exclusive Amenities at Giggbang Laundromat

Giggbang Laundromat isn’t just a destination for laundry; it’s a comprehensive solution for busy individuals and businesses seeking convenience and efficiency.

Amenities like free Wi-Fi, a play area for kids, and a café make it a one-stop shop for multitasking customers. Moreover, the facility also incorporates eco-friendly practices, such as using energy-efficient machines and recycled water, contributing to its growing popularity.

State-of-the-Art Machinery

At the core of Giggbang Laundromat’s success lies its robust and modern machinery. The laundromat boasts over 50 state-of-the-art washing machines and dryers, ensuring quick turnaround times and maximum capacity utilization.

From industrial-sized washers to high-speed dryers and even specialized stain-removal equipment, Giggbang’s machinery is designed to handle diverse laundry needs. This wide range of appliances makes it an ideal choice for both households and businesses, including hotel linens, gym wear, and restaurant uniforms.

Convenient Location and Timings

Strategically located in the heart of Bengaluru, Giggbang Laundromat draws a diverse clientele from various residential and commercial areas. Its proximity to both residential colonies and commercial hubs ensures a steady stream of customers.

Operating on an extended schedule – from 8 AM to 10 PM on weekdays and 9 AM to 9 PM on weekends – Giggbang caters to the city’s bustling urban life. This flexible timing allows customers to undertake their laundry chores at their convenience, thereby enhancing customer satisfaction.
